Outbound Dialing Should Use Updated Phone Number After Agent Lead Update
Description:
Currently, when an agent updates the phone number in a lead record (Agent Lead Update), the system continues to dial the old phone number during the outbound call process. Although the lead information reflects the new number in both the Lead Search and Lead View pages, the dialing logic still references the outdated number.
Expected Behavior:
When a lead’s phone number is updated by an agent, the system should immediately reference and use the updated number for any subsequent outbound dialing attempts, without requiring the lead to be re-passed or refreshed.
Actual Behavior:
Updated lead details display correctly in Lead Search and Lead View.
Outbound dial attempts still target the old number.
Tier 3 RingCX confirmed that the lead isn’t refreshed until after it’s passed, which is the current expected behavior.
Impact:
This can lead to failed or misdirected outbound calls, inefficiency in contact handling, and potential customer confusion.
Proposed Enhancement:
Enable the system to refresh and use the updated lead phone number immediately upon saving changes, ensuring outbound calls reflect the most recent data.
